ZIP 37031 is wealthier than most US places, with a median household income of $98,114. Population has held roughly steady since 2024. 21%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, below the national rate of 36%. Median home value is $352,600. With a median age of 53.5, the population is older than the US median of 38.9. Among the 7 ZIP codes in Sumner County, 37031 ranks 3rd by median household income.
How many people live in ZIP code 37031?
ZIP code 37031 has about 3,926 residents according to the 2024 American Community Survey.
What is the median household income in ZIP code 37031?
The typical household in ZIP code 37031 earns about $98,114 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is ZIP code 37031 expensive?
In ZIP code 37031, the median home is worth about $352,600.
How educated are people in ZIP code 37031?
About 21.2% of adults age 25 and over in ZIP code 37031 h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in ZIP code 37031?
About 8.3% of people in ZIP code 37031 live below the federal poverty line.
